Certified Police Officer

Suffield, CT
Suffield Police Department

Salary: $79,206 to $99,091

Essential Functions:

  • The Town of Suffield seeks qualified applicants for the position of Certified Police Officer. This is a full time (40 hour per week), hourly position in the Police Department. Some of the duties include but are not limited to: patrolling an assigned area on foot or in a motor vehicle to enforce laws and to prevent, detect and investigate complaints, motor vehicle violations and crimes.
  • He or she makes arrests, interviews suspects and witnesses, takes written statements, prepares written reports, assists other town agencies, administers CPR and/or first aid, directs traffic, as well as testifies in court.

Requirements:

• Education: Applicants must be a high school graduate or possess a GED.
• License: Applicants must possess and maintain a valid driver’s license.
• Residency: Applicants must be U.S. citizens and reside within a twenty-five (25) mile radius of the Police Department within one (1) year after completion of the department’s field training program.
• Drug Testing: Applicants shall be required to submit to a drug test as part of the preemployment medical examination.
• Character Requirements and other factors: Applicants must meet the highest legal and ethical standards. Honesty and integrity are paramount to the profession. Candidates will undergo a rigorous background investigation, including a polygraph, before any offer of employment. An applicant may be disqualified for poor employment history, recent use of illegal drugs, or previously undetected criminal activity.
